Thermo Fisher Scientific (TMO) a healthcare juggernaut you cannot ignore
Thermo Fisher Scientific (NYSE: TMO) is a healthcare sector juggernaut that produces and supplies scientific instruments, reagents, consumables and offers contract services through its CDM and CRO businesses. With a galaxy of critical services and products, Thermo Fisher is a force to be reckoned with in healthcare.

What is proteomics?
During the expression of a protein-coding gene, information flows from DNA → RNA →protein. This directional flow of information is known as the central dogma of molecular biology. (Learn more about DNA and RNA in our previous articles.)
